California Asian Art Auction Gallery's Fine Asian Works of Art auction on Feb. 26 and 27, 2022 will present rare and magnificent pieces, including important Qing/Ming ceramics, Ming/Qing jade carvings, Chinese classical and modern paintings, and other exceptional pieces from various North American private collections.
